Ah, so here I see missing second device support.

It is still confusing to see that you use here some sort of
autodetection, but in the same time not.

The two sensors that I included in this driver have some similarities, but also differences, for which I used the platform data. I made separate patches for the two sensors, such that it is visible how much is common/different.  The chip_id reading is for validating that the sensor that is actually attached matches the device tree. It happens to me sometimes, that I switch the sensors, but forget to switch the dtb, and it helps to see which sensor is actually attached. Also, it helps a lot when the evaluation board is in some remote lab and I am unsure what sensor is attached to it.

I saw most sensor drivers have some kind of identification of the sensor module by the means of reading the chip_id register. Some examples with multiple compatibles supported and chip_id validation: imx296, ov9650, ov772x.
